Summary
A vulnerability, which was classified as problematic, has been found in Synology RADIUS Server. This issue affects some unknown processing. The manipulation leads to cross site scripting. This vulnerability is referenced as CVE-2024-13987. Remote exploitation of the attack is possible. No exploit is available. It is advisable to upgrade the affected component.
Details
A vulnerability was found in Synology RADIUS Server. It has been rated as problematic. This issue affects an unknown functionality. The manipulation with an unknown input leads to a cross site scripting vulnerability. Using CWE to declare the problem leads to CWE-79. The product does not neutralize or incorrectly neutralizes user-controllable input before it is placed in output that is used as a web page that is served to other users. Impacted is integrity. The summary by CVE is:
Improper neutralization of input during web page generation ('Cross-site Scripting') vulnerability in Synology RADIUS Server before 3.0.27-0139 allows remote authenticated users with administrator privileges to read or write limited files in SRM and conduct limited denial-of-service via unspecified vectors.
The weakness was published by Only Hack In Cave as SA_25_10. It is possible to read the advisory at synology.com. The identification of this vulnerability is CVE-2024-13987 since 08/29/2025. The exploitation is known to be easy. The attack may be initiated remotely. The exploitation requires an enhanced level of successful authentication. It demands that the victim is doing some kind of user interaction. The technical details are unknown and an exploit is not publicly available. The attack technique deployed by this issue is T1059.007 according to MITRE ATT&CK.
Upgrading to version 3.0.27-0139 eliminates this vulnerability.
